Why a Thank You Letter Matters

After attending a panel interview, it is crucial to follow up with a thank you letter. This simple act can leave a lasting impression on the interviewers and increase your chances of being selected for the job. Expressing gratitude for the opportunity to interview and reiterating your interest in the position shows professionalism and dedication. Additionally, sending a thank you letter allows you to recap important points discussed during the interview and emphasize your qualifications.

When to Send the Thank You Letter

Timing is important when it comes to sending a thank you letter after a panel interview. Aim to send it within 24 to 48 hours of the interview. This timeframe allows you to strike a balance between showing promptness and giving the interviewers enough time to process their decision. Sending the thank you letter too early may make you appear desperate, while waiting too long can make you seem disinterested. So, make sure to find the right balance.

How to Format the Thank You Letter

When writing a thank you letter, it is essential to maintain a professional and polite tone. Use a formal email format and address each interviewer individually. Begin with a formal salutation and express your gratitude for the opportunity to interview. Then, briefly mention key points discussed during the interview and highlight how your skills align with the job requirements. Conclude the letter by reiterating your interest in the position and thanking the interviewers again for their time and consideration.

Personalizing the Thank You Letter

To make your thank you letter stand out, personalize it by referencing specific details from the interview. Recall a particular question or topic that you found interesting and briefly mention it in the letter. This shows that you were attentive during the interview and reinforces your genuine interest in the position. Personalization also helps the interviewers remember you among other candidates.

Proofread and Edit

Before sending your thank you letter, ensure that it is error-free. Proofread the letter multiple times to catch any spelling or grammatical mistakes. Pay attention to formatting, sentence structure, and punctuation. A well-written and error-free letter demonstrates your attention to detail and professionalism. You can also ask a friend or family member to review the letter for any overlooked errors.

Following Up

If you haven’t heard back from the interviewers within a week, it is appropriate to follow up with a polite email. Express your continued interest in the position and inquire about the status of the hiring process. Keep the email concise and professional. This follow-up shows that you are proactive and genuinely interested in the job.

Sample Thank You Letter

Subject: Thank You for the Panel Interview Opportunity

Dear [Interviewer’s Name],

I would like to express my sincere gratitude for the opportunity to interview for the [Job Title] position at [Company Name]. It was a pleasure meeting the panel and discussing the role in detail.

I was particularly intrigued by the question regarding [specific topic]. It made me realize how [relevant skill or experience] would be valuable in this position. I am confident that my [mention specific skills] align perfectly with the job requirements and can contribute to the success of [Company Name].

Once again, I would like to thank you for your time and consideration. I remain excited about the possibility of joining the team at [Company Name] and contributing to its continued growth. If there are any additional documents or references you require, please do not hesitate to let me know.

Thank you for your attention, and I look forward to hearing from you soon.

Sincerely,

[Your Name]
